Background:  The Monday Civic Club of Tacoma was established in 1910 by a group of women active in charitable organizations who saw the need for a club devoted entirely to civic matters.  The goal was to focus attention and funds on organizations and causes not being helped by other clubs.  Club activities centered on distributing baskets of clothing and food to families in need, fund raising activities such as card parties and rummage sales, and the making of sweaters and socks for the Red Cross.  As the Monday Civic Club matured, members focused on conservation programs and campaigns against air and water pollution. It sponsored school essay and poster contests about conservation problems.  The Monday Civic Club continued to promote and raise money for various charitable groups and was the first organization to raise funds for the Sea Otter pool at the Pt. Defiance Park Zoo in Tacoma.  The Monday Civic Club was affiliated with both Washington State and National Federations of Women’s Clubs and also belonged to the Tacoma and Pierce County President’s Council of Women’s Organizations.

 

Scope and Content:  The records include two minutes books, which detail requestsfor assistance and charitable projects of the club, 1940-1949, 1967-1973; five scrapbooks, 1952-1968; 13 yearbooks, 1942-1980; miscellaneous newspaper clippings, photographs, correspondence, awards, event programs, and memos.
